We have a habit of setting great quarterly goals during our sessions, but then we struggle to keep our focus as the weeks go on. How do you help us maintain our discipline and execute our Rocks when you are not in the room with us?

The real work of EOS® happens in the eighty-nine days between our sessions. To maintain your momentum, you must build a daily and weekly habit of execution that does not rely on my physical presence.

We do this by instilling a rigorous weekly meeting cadence. Your weekly Level 10 Meeting™ is the heartbeat of your business. This meeting is designed to keep your team aligned, track your weekly progress, and rapidly solve problems before they derail your quarterly goals. We teach your team how to run this meeting effectively, ensuring that every session is productive, focused, and free of politics.

We also encourage teams to embrace the concept of daily successes to fight natural operational resistance. This means breaking down large, intimidating Rocks into small, manageable weekly milestones. When your team sees consistent, incremental progress, it builds the confidence and momentum needed to stay on track. By establishing these structured habits, your team gains the discipline required to execute your business strategy consistently and drive the business toward a clean exit.
